The Pros And Cons Of Magnetic Cable Holders In 2026

Magnetic cable holders have become increasingly popular in 2026 as a convenient solution for managing electronic cables. They offer a sleek and modern way to keep cables organized, especially in workspaces and homes. However, like any technology, they come with their own set of advantages and disadvantages that users should consider before adopting them.

Advantages of Magnetic Cable Holders

  • Ease of Use: Magnetic holders allow for quick attachment and detachment of cables, making it simple to connect devices without fumbling.
  • Organizational Benefits: They help keep cables tidy, reducing clutter on desks and workstations.
  • Compatibility: Magnetic holders can be used with various cable types, including USB, HDMI, and charging cords.
  • Design Aesthetics: Their sleek design complements modern electronic setups, adding a minimalist touch.
  • Reduced Wear and Tear: By holding cables securely, they prevent unnecessary bending or twisting that can damage wires.

Disadvantages of Magnetic Cable Holders

  • Magnetic Interference: Strong magnets may interfere with sensitive electronic components or magnetic storage devices.
  • Potential Damage: Magnetic fields can sometimes affect the internal components of certain devices, especially those with magnetic storage.
  • Limited Strength: Some magnetic holders may not hold heavier or thicker cables securely, leading to accidental drops.
  • Compatibility Issues: Magnetic materials may not be compatible with all types of cables or connectors, especially those with metal casings.
  • Cost: High-quality magnetic cable holders tend to be more expensive than traditional clips or ties.

As technology advances, magnetic cable holders are expected to become smarter, integrating features like wireless charging compatibility and smart organization. However, users should remain cautious about magnetic interference and device compatibility. Choosing the right magnetic holder involves balancing convenience, safety, and cost.
